How do the characteristics of Robert Wagner and Alfred E. Smith compare?
IrinaVladis [17]

The most important characteristic between these two men is a life dedicated to politics and from it the defense of similar ideas. Both were democrats. And as a common denominator, both have a migrant origin. They rose gradually in political life from administrative positions to the Senate - Wagner - and the New York Governorate - Smith.

Their humble origins of working parents identified them with the struggle for better conditions for the people.

They used their power to defend causes that improved the lives of workers and disadvantaged classes.

His progressive ideas brought them closer to the appreciation of Roosevelt, who always showed them the greatest sympathy.

Read the excerpt from chapter 23 of The Adventures of Huckleberry Finn. "All right, then—not a word about any sell. Go along hom
Ludmilka [50]

Answer: gullible.

In this excerpt, the people from Arkansas who decided to go see the show are extremely unhappy with the way it turned out. However, they are embarrased because the theatre company has deceived them and taken their money. Therefore, instead of telling everyone else how deceptive the practice was, they will keep it secret out of embarrasment. Moreover, they will advise everyone to go see the play. Therefore, it is clear that the townspeople are afraid of being seen as gullible.
